    Cody, does it matter what kind of paint you use on the block? I would hate to see all that hard work get damaged by the heat of the engine.
     
  12. If it's Urethane he's good to go. Have done lots and never a problem with heat. Old straight Enamel works good too but takes about a week to dry.
